Position Summary
We are looking for a motivated and dependable Warehouse Lead to become a key part of our operations team. This hands-on role combines warehouse responsibilities with local driving duties to support the efficient movement of goods in and out of our facility. The successful candidate will be responsible for maintaining accurate inventory, loading and unloading materials, and delivering products safely and on time to various destinations. This position requires strong attention to detail, a proactive work ethic, and the ability to handle equipment and vehicles responsibly. Additional tasks may include general warehouse, facility and lot maintenance, as well as other duties as assigned. If you're a team player with a strong sense of accountability and a desire to grow within a dynamic and supportive environment, we want to hear from you
Essential functions of the job include but are not limited to:
- Safely load and unload products from delivery vehicles and warehouse storage locations.
- Operate commercial equipment includes forklifts, trailers, and stack body dump trucks in accordance with safety protocols and company policies.
- Drive company vehicles, such as box trucks and stake body trucks, and dump body trucks, to transport goods and materials to various locations, including company satellite sites.
- Tow and maneuver trailers as needed for deliveries or warehouse operations, including travel to satellite locations to support logistics and distribution needs.
- Accurately track inventory movements and maintain up-to-date delivery logs and documentation.
- Ensure compliance with all safety regulations while operating equipment and driving vehicles.
- Conduct routine inspections and basic maintenance checks on vehicles and equipment, reporting any mechanical or safety issues promptly.
- Collaborate with warehouse staff and supervisors to support efficient day-to-day operations.
Qualifications
Minimum Required:
- Minimum 2 years of experience supervising or leading teams in warehouse, logistics, or maintenance operations. Proven ability to delegate tasks, train team members, and ensure workflow efficiency.
- At least 4 years of hands-on experience in warehouse settings, including inventory management, order fulfillment, shipping/receiving, and facility upkeep.
- Certified or previously certified in forklift operation, with proven ability to safely operate heavy equipment such as forklifts, pallet jacks, and trailers in compliance with OSHA standards.
- Valid driver’s license with a minimum of 1 year of experience driving commercial vehicles with trailers (2+ years preferred).
- Completion of OSHA 10-hour safety training or equivalent, with a solid understanding of workplace safety protocols in both warehouse and vehicle operations.
- Ability to lift and move up to 50 lbs independently and up to 100 lbs with assistance. Must be capable of performing physical tasks related to warehouse, facility, and lot maintenance.
- Strong attention to detail with the ability to accurately track inventory, maintain records, and follow schedules under minimal supervision.
- Demonstrates reliability, initiative, and the ability to work both independently and as part of a team in fast-paced environments.
- Effective verbal and written communication skills; bilingual in Spanish is a plus.
- Willingness to perform other duties as assigned, including general facility and lot maintenance.
